Steel Springs

Steel springs are indispensable components in countless mechanical assemblies. By harnessing steel’s remarkable tensile strength and elasticity, these springs store and release energy with precision, ensuring reliable performance under continuous loading and unloading.

Key Material Properties

Steel springs can be tailored through wire diameter, coil geometry and metallurgical processes to deliver:

  • High tensile strength & elasticity: Absorbs substantial energy and returns it smoothly.
  • Excellent fatigue resistance: Maintains performance over millions of cycles.
  • Broad temperature tolerance: Operates effectively from sub-zero environments up to 400 °C.


There are also Customisable alloy grades & treatments such as:

  • Cold-drawn low-alloy steels for superior finish and tensile strength
  • Oil-hardening spring steels for enhanced yield strength
  • Duplex and high-temperature stainless steels for corrosion and heat resistance
  • Precision quenching, tempering and shot peening to boost fatigue life

Stainless Steel Springs

For applications demanding corrosion resistance and hygiene—such as medical, food processing or outdoor equipment—stainless steel springs are unbeatable. Key advantages include:

  • Superior corrosion resistance: in humid, chemical or saline environments
  • Clean finish: ideal for both industrial and consumer-facing uses
  • Thermal durability: maintained under repeated washdowns and elevated heat
  • Non-magnetic options: available via specialised annealing for sensitive devices
  • Tailorable alloys: (chromium, nickel, molybdenum) to optimise yield strength and corrosion performance

 

Applications of Steel Springs

Steel springs feature across a wealth of sectors, for example:

  • Aerospace: Landing-gear shock absorbers, actuator assemblies
  • Automotive: Suspension systems, valve and clutch springs
  • Electronics: Connectors, battery contacts and switches
  • Medical Devices: Surgical instruments, implantable mechanisms
  • Food & Beverage: Dispensing systems, conveyor tensioners
  • Outdoor & Marine: Deck hardware, hatch closures and dampers
